Warning Signs You Need Under-Cabinet Water Extraction

Catching water damage early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Don’t ignore these warning signs – they could be a sign that you need under-cabinet water extraction: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Hidden Dangers – Musty odors can be a sign of hidden moisture, mold, and mildew growth in your cabinets. Don’t ignore these odors – they could be a sign that you need under-cabinet water extraction. Our team will help you identify the source of the odor and take steps to prevent further growth.

Water Stains or Mineral Deposits

Signs of Damage – Water stains or mineral deposits on your cabinets can be a sign of water damage. Don’t ignore these signs – they could be a sign that you need under-cabinet water extraction. Our team will help you identify the source of the damage and take steps to prevent further problems.

Warped or Buckled Cabinets

Structural Damage – Warped or buckled cabinets can be a sign of structural damage to your home. Don’t ignore these signs – they could be a sign that you need under-cabinet water extraction. Our team will help you identify the source of the damage and take steps to prevent further problems.

Under-Cabinet Water Extraction Cost in Swansea, MA

The cost of under-cabinet water extraction can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Swansea, MA. Our team will provide you with a free estimate and help you understand what to expect in terms of costs and timelines.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Inspection and Assessment $200-$1,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area
Water Extraction $500-$2,500 Severity of damage, size of affected area
Drying and Cleaning $300-$1,500 Severity of damage, size of affected area

The cost of under-cabinet water extraction can also depend on the equipment and techniques used, as well as the expertise of the technician. Our team will provide you with a free estimate and help you understand what to expect in terms of costs and timelines.
